### 精通HTML之标记大整理
#### 文件标记
- **<HTML>**:文件声明标记,用于告诉浏览器这是一个HTML文档。这是每个HTML页面必须包含的第一个标记。
- **<HEAD>**:头部标记,用来放置文档元数据,如标题、样式链接、脚本等,这些内容不会显示在页面中。
- **<TITLE>**:标题标记,定义了文档的标题,通常显示在浏览器的标题栏或者标签页。
- **<BODY>**:主体标记,用于包含页面上的主要内容,包括文本、图片、链接等。
#### 排版标记
- **<P>**:段落标记,用于创建一个新的段落,浏览器会自动在前后添加空白行。
- **<BR>**:换行标记,用于在不创建新段落的情况下进行换行。
- **<HR>**:水平线标记,用于在页面中插入一条水平分割线。
- **<CENTER>**:居中标记,使元素在页面中居中对齐。
- **<PRE>**:预格式化文本标记,保留文本中的空格和换行符,常用于代码展示。
- **<DIV>**:区隔标记,用于定义文档中的分区或节,通常作为其他元素的容器。
- **<NOBR>**:非换行标记,用于强制文本在同一行显示,不自动换行。
- **<WBR>**:建议换行标记,用于在指定位置建议浏览器换行,但并非强制。
#### 字体标记
- **<STRONG>**:强调重要性,通常表现为加粗字体。
- **<B>**:粗体标记,用于设置文本为粗体。
- **<EM>**:强调标记,通常表现为斜体字体。
- **<I>**:斜体标记,用于设置文本为斜体。
- **<TT>**:打字机字体标记,用于模拟打字机的字体样式。
- **<U>**:下划线标记,用于给文本添加下划线。
- **<H1>-<H6>**:标题标记,用于定义不同级别的标题,其中`<H1>`级别最高,`<H6>`级别最低。
- **<FONT>**:字体标记,用于定义字体的样式、大小和颜色。
- **<BIG>**:增大字体标记,用于增大文本的字号。
- **<SMALL>**:缩小字体标记,用于减小文本的字号。
- **<STRIKE>**:删除线标记,用于给文本添加删除线。
- **<CODE>**:代码标记,用于显示编程代码或命令行文本。
- **<KBD>**:键盘输入标记,用于表示键盘输入,通常用于用户界面的描述。
- **<SAMP>**:样本标记,用于显示程序输出的样本文本。
- **<VAR>**:变量标记,用于表示变量名。
- **<CITE>**:引用标记,用于表示作品的标题。
- **<BLOCKQUOTE>**:块引用标记,用于表示较长的引用文本,通常会缩进。
- **<DFN>**:定义标记,用于定义术语或缩写词。
- **<ADDRESS>**:地址标记,用于表示作者或文档所有者的联系信息。
- **<SUB>**:下标标记,用于设置下标文本。
- **<SUP>**:上标标记,用于设置上标文本。
#### 清单标记
- **<OL>**:有序列表标记,列表项按数字或字母排序。
- **<UL>**:无序列表标记,列表项前默认带有圆点符号。
- **<LI>**:列表项标记,用于定义列表中的每一项。
- **<MENU>**:菜单列表标记,类似无序列表,但在某些浏览器中有特殊样式。
- **<DIR>**:目录列表标记,同样类似于无序列表,但已过时。
- **<DL>**:定义列表标记,由定义标题和定义内容组成。
- **<DT>**:定义标题标记,定义列表中的标题。
- **<DD>**:定义内容标记,定义列表中的内容部分。
#### 表格标记
- **<TABLE>**:表格标记,用于创建表格。
- **<CAPTION>**:表格标题标记,用于给表格添加标题。
- **<TR>**:表格行标记,定义表格中的一行。
- **<TD>**:表格单元格标记,定义表格中的一个单元格。
- **<TH>**:表格表头标记,定义表格中的表头单元格,通常用于标识列。
#### 表单标记
- **<FORM>**:表单标记,用于创建表单,收集用户输入的数据。
- **<TEXTAREA>**:文本区域标记,用于创建多行文本输入框。
- **<INPUT>**:输入标记,用于创建不同类型的输入控件,如文本框、按钮等。
- **<SELECT>**:选择标记,用于创建下拉列表。
- **<OPTION>**:选项标记,定义下拉列表中的每个选项。
#### 图形标记
- **<IMG>**:图像标记,用于在文档中嵌入图像。
#### 连结标记
- **<A>**:锚点标记(链接标记),用于创建超链接,连接到另一个文档或文档内的位置。
#### 框架标记
- **<FRAMESET>**:框架集标记,用于定义页面布局的框架结构。
- **<FRAME>**:框架标记,用于定义页面中的一个独立窗口或框架。
- **<IFRAME>**:内联框架标记,用于在文档中嵌入另一个HTML文档。
- **<NOFRAMES>**:非框架标记,用于提供一个替代文本或内容,当浏览器不支持框架时显示。
#### 影像地图
- **<MAP>**:映射标记,用于定义图像映射。
- **<AREA>**:区域标记,用于定义图像映射中的可点击区域。
#### 多媒体标记
- **<BGSOUND>**:背景声音标记,用于在页面加载时播放背景音乐。
- **<EMBED>**:嵌入标记,用于嵌入多媒体内容,如Flash动画、视频等。
以上是HTML中常用的一些标记,这些标记构成了网页的基本结构,并帮助开发者更好地组织和呈现内容。了解并掌握这些标记的使用方法对于编写结构清晰、语义正确的HTML文档至关重要。
评论0
最新资源